Output 63ea3cfdfaa419a0ed507a2b29b9b0fff68712a82ea658202521c13b64facc31:2

value
543000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a349caeb42209f7dfc211b93ae54af374ee8d91 OP_EQUAL
address
32cyi1aNUhw7bFeqwUYjeKbu4J9QDhhuS1
transaction
63ea3cfdfaa419a0ed507a2b29b9b0fff68712a82ea658202521c13b64facc31
spent
true